British tug Christine 1966-


In the locks entering inner harbour of Vlissingen, Netherlands

United Kingdom-flagged, homeport Plymouth, MMSI 235051179 and callsign MQPQ6. Former British naval tug Christine (A217). Built at the shipyard of Isaac Pimblottt, Northwich, England in 1966. Dimensions 72’6” x 20’6” x 8’2” and a gross tonnage of 76,61 and net of 47.07 tons. Speed in naval service 10 knots with a horsepower of 495 bhp and a range of 2.000 nautical miles. Bollard pull 6 tons. Crew numbered in naval service 4 men. An improved Girl-class design. Of AJ&A Pratt Marine Towage Contractors no. 912902.
